KSA: Saudi Ministry of Health plans 100 partnership projects valued at US$13bn

-

Saudi Health Minister Fahd Al-Jalajil has revealed a plan to involve the private sector in more than 100 health projects over the next five years, with investment opportunities estimated at…

Nick Herbert has over 30 years’ experience in the financial markets, as both a practitioner and journalist. He started work as an investment banker in London, before joining International Financing Review (IFR) to report on debt capital markets and derivatives. He moved to Singapore in 2000 to manage IFR’s financial markets editorial team throughout Asia, before returning to London in 2009 to take up the position of Publisher for Reuters Capital Markets Publications. For the last five years he has been covering global capital markets, ESG finance and healthcare markets on a freelance basis.
